MIDDLE HOUSING ZONING "Middle Housing" is a new zoning classification adopted by the City on October 27, 2022 ( Ordinance #2022-4399 ). This classification was created to: Accommodate an ever-growing student population, Acknowledge the reality of what was already happening in some neighborhoods, and Provide protection to other neighborhoods from incompatible housing types (Ag Shacks, etc.). SHARED HOUSING STRUCTURE CLASSIFICATION In the late 1990's and early 2000's, developers and investors figured out that a lot of money can be made with over-occupancy and that enforcement by the city was difficult. They then began building what are commonly known as "Ag Shacks" (The name of one of the early companies that promoted these structures.) or "stealth dorms." What Is A Stealth Dorm?
"Stealth Dorm" is a catch-all term for any house in a residential neighborhood that is occupied by four or more unrelated individuals. In the case of College Station, those individuals are usually college students. The negative effects of stealth dorms on neighborhoods are discussed elsewhere on CSANs web site, but there may be some confusion about what exactly constitutes a "stealth dorm."
